Dryscape Landscaping in Ventura County, CA
Dryscape landscaping services focus on creating functional and visually appealing outdoor spaces using materials such as decomposed granite, gravel, crushed stone, and other dry-set aggregates. These projects often include designing low-maintenance walkways, patios, pathways, and decorative ground covers that do not require extensive irrigation or ongoing watering. Property owners typically seek dryscape solutions to enhance curb appeal, improve drainage, or establish a durable landscape that withstands local climate conditions with minimal upkeep.
Before requesting dryscape services, homeowners should consider the specific features they want to incorporate into their outdoor areas, such as pathways, seating areas, or decorative accents. It’s helpful to understand the overall style desired, the level of foot traffic the space will receive, and any existing landscape elements that may influence the project. Clarifying these details can assist in selecting appropriate materials and designing a landscape that aligns with the property's aesthetic and functional goals.

Dryscape Landscaping Questions
What is dryscape landscaping? Dryscape landscaping involves designing outdoor spaces with drought-tolerant plants, rocks, and other materials to reduce water use and maintenance.
What types of projects are suitable for dryscape landscaping? It is ideal for gardens, front yards, and around patios where low water consumption and minimal upkeep are desired.
How does dryscape landscaping benefit a property? It enhances curb appeal, conserves water, and creates a low-maintenance outdoor environment.
What materials are commonly used in dryscape designs? Common materials include gravel, decorative rocks, drought-resistant plants, and mulch for a natural look.
